How does Peptide Program work?

Consultation
Review goals, medical history, meds, allergies, contraindications.
Lifestyle support
Nutrition, sleep, stress, activity recommendations designed for you.
Personalized plan
Medication, dose, personalised route, cycle length, and follow ups.
Monitoring
Checkins at 2–4 weeks initially, then every 1–3 months. Dose adjustments as needed.

What is Klearmind’s approach to Ketamine Therapy?

FAQ icon

Our core philosophy is to treat every patient like family, with infusions individually dosed based on factors like weight, metabolism, and current medications. While ketamine can be given orally, sublingually, intranasally, or intramuscularly, intravenous (IV) infusions allow precise, individualized dosing. IV ketamine is the route most studied in clinical research for depression and other psychiatric conditions.
